Pearl Harbor: Why Should You Care?

A seemingly unprovoked attack at Pearl Harbor was the perfect method to change the American’s minds.
At 7:55 am on December 7, 1941, Pearl Harbor was attacked by the Japanese. Five battleships, three cruisers, and three destroyers were sunk with other ships damaged; 188 aircraft were destroyed on the ground; 2,403 U.S. soldiers, sailors, and civilians were killed with 1,178 wounded.
